Planning Your Full Moon Hike

Before heading out on your hike, be sure to:

  • Check the trail conditions: Visit the official websites or contact local authorities for up-to-date information on trail closures or maintenance.
  • Bring necessary gear: Pack a flashlight or headlamp, as well as any other essentials like water, snacks, and first aid supplies.
  • Respect the environment: Follow Leave No Trace principles to minimize your impact on the natural surroundings.

What to Expect

Hiking under the full moon offers a unique experience. As you walk through the darkness, the landscape comes alive with sounds and scents that might go unnoticed during the day. Keep an eye out for nocturnal creatures like owls, bats, and even the occasional coyote.
